1. Apply Perfume on Moisturised Skin

Dry skin causes fragrance to evaporate faster. For best results:

  • Apply an unscented moisturiser before spraying perfume

  • Focus on pulse points such as wrists, neck, and behind the ears

Moisturised skin helps lock in scent molecules, making your perfume last longer throughout the day.


2. Use the Right Pulse Points (Less Is More)

Arabian perfumes are powerful — you don’t need many sprays.

Best pulse points for Arabian fragrances:

  • Neck and collarbone

  • Behind the ears

  • Inner elbows

  • One light spray on clothing (optional)

For oil-rich perfumes from brands like Lattafa Perfumes or Afnan, 1–3 sprays are usually enough.


3. Don’t Rub Your Perfume

Rubbing your wrists together breaks down fragrance molecules and destroys the top notes.
Instead:

  • Spray

  • Let the perfume dry naturally

This is especially important for oud-, amber-, and vanilla-based Arabian perfumes.


4. Choose Long-Lasting Arabian Notes

Some notes naturally last longer than others. If longevity is your priority, look for perfumes with:

  • Oud

  • Amber

  • Musk

  • Vanilla

  • Woods

5. Layer Your Fragrance for Extra Longevity

Fragrance layering is a traditional Middle Eastern practice.

How to layer Arabian perfumes:

  1. Start with a matching body lotion or oil

  2. Apply perfume oil (if available)

  3. Finish with an eau de parfum spray

This technique dramatically increases longevity and depth.


6. Apply Lightly on Clothes (With Care)

Arabian perfumes tend to cling well to fabric.

  • Spray lightly on scarves, coats, or collars

  • Avoid delicate or light-coloured fabrics

A single spray on clothing can help your fragrance last all day, especially in cooler UK weather.


7. Store Your Perfume Properly

Heat and light can damage perfume oils.

For best results:

  • Store perfumes in a cool, dark place

  • Keep bottles tightly closed

  • Avoid leaving perfumes in cars or near windows

Proper storage helps maintain the strength and quality of your fragrance.
